Fórum Dll #14909
01/02/2010
0
Existe algum modo de debug um dll, tem tempo de execução?
Alexandro Oliveira
Curtir tópico
+ 0
Responder
Posts
02/02/2010
Rodrigo Mourão
Sim Existe sim.
Geralmente vc tem uma app que usa a dll e o projeto da dll. Abre o projeto da dll no delphi, coloque o break point onde quer parar. Feito isso execute a aplicação que vc utiliza, pode ser por dentro do delphi ou por fora.
COm o exe rodando va no menu Run do dlephi e clique em Attach to Process. Isso vai abrir um tela com todos os processos em execução na maquina. Selecione a aplicacao e clique em atach.
Isso irá carregar a dll em memoria e parar a execução. Pressione F9 e use a aplicação normalmente. Quando a APP chamar a dll irá parar no break Point.
Espero ter ajudado.
Abs!!
Responder
Gostei + 0
Clique aqui para fazer login e interagir na Comunidade :)